5.0 out of 5 stars Excellent Bargain Box of Liszt, 7 Aug 2008
By Mr. Mark A. Meldon (Somerset UK) - See all my reviews
(REAL NAME)      
One of EMI's bargain box sets, this 7 CD set contains a vast amount of Liszt's orchestral pieces and his works for piano and orchestra; pretty much all you need from this neglected composer (other than his amazing piano works, of course - see the stupendous Naxos series).

A key figure in nineteenth-century music, Liszt has been sadly relegated by certain critics to an also-ran. Nothing could be further from the truth. A proponent of "music of the future", Liszt popularised "programme music". This means that a lot of these pieces have a narrative theme, rather than being "absolute music", like Brahms, for example. Nowadays, these distinctions mean little - as long as music is good, I like it.

Kurt Masur and the Gewandhaus Orchester Leipzig, with Michael Beroff on piano, set these recordings down in what was the DDR between 1977 and 1980. This set was digitally remastered between 1990 and 1996, and the sound is very good indeed.

The box contains 7 CDs in card sleeves, with a brief but helpful booklet.

I won't list (no pun intended) all of the contents. You do achieve a complete set of Liszt's tone-poems, the Dante and Faust "symphonies" and the two piano concertos. I can't fault the performances in any way - there are not many alternative sets available - and you should try listening without predujice to these works. I have come to "classical" music ("notated music"?) form the world of rock and I think Liszt is quite a good way into this type of music if you are travelling the same path.

The ignored Liszt was a genius, your appreciation starts here!

5.0 out of 5 stars Nineteenth Century Avant-Garde!, 6 Dec 2008
By J. Gibbons (London, UK) - See all my reviews
(REAL NAME)   
During the years just before the reunification of Germany the East German (DDR) record company VEB undertook several major recording projects in conjunction with various western labels (EMI, Phillips, Teldec, etc) with major East German orchestras. Rudolf Kempe returned to Dresden for his highly acclaimed Richard Strauss series and the Leipzig Gewandhaus under their then regular conductor Kurt Masur taped this first class set of Liszt's orchestral works together with those for piano and orchestra. It is a major achievement and deserves the widest possible circulation.

The Leipzig Gewandhaus as this time was a superb ensemble and Masur obviously relishes their virtuosity. His readings of this repetoire are swift and beautifully phrased. Because of their lack of idiosincracy they are ideal for repeated listening and, to my mind, preferable to the Haitink series which, of course, is not so comprehensive.

This music is, with a few exceptions (notably the Piano Concertos and 'Les Preludes'), not widely recorded or, indeed, well known. It all shows Lizst's absolute mastery of orchestration, splendid thematic material, and totally original, forward thinking, harmonic experimentation. It is also extremely enjoyable.

The late analogue recording quality is first class and the remastering well up to EMI's usual high standard. Highly recommended.
